Went Gnosis 1 and having the hardest time with Velmorne by seductiveapple174 in Witchfire

[–]seintris_ 4 points5 points  (0 children)

Velmourne is harder than Irongate, I think. So much of the map is very dense, and it's easy to be surrounded or jammed up against a wall. The spiders really don't help. Take it slow and use Echo. If your guns aren't on the third mysterium get them there. Easiest way to do it is go to Island of the Damned, If you're dealing with those boss monsters, like the executioner and sepulchre, just freeze them with whatever you have, walk up, and let Echo do the work for you. I generally like to use bolt actions, but I found that for Velmourne specifically I switch to a more crowd control focused build. Rotten fiend is excellent to help draw aggro. Ice sphere is nice to freeze everything coming at you, and synergizes excellently with Echo. I switched to Richochet for my primary and used Lightning bolt and either the ice dome or rotten field. Crown of fire was essential to apply burn and let the Richochet's third mysterium or the lightning bolt start the electric fire element combination chain. If anything needed to die, I just swapped to the Echo. It's the best gun in the game, I think, for "X enemy must die right now." The downside to this setup is that you can't engage from mid to long range, which for other maps is probably the most important range. Velmourne, though, is almost entirely intense close quarters engagements, which is why it fucked me so hard at first. I cleared Irongate on Gnosis V messing around with Duelist and Nemesis on second mysterium but couldn't clear Velmourne with my preferred loadout at first. Every other map in the game lets you sit back or has a place to retreat. Not so much Velmourne. You have to make sure you have a get off me button, a way to control crowds (lots of people will tell you burning stake / stormball, but honestly I just don't like the combo. Not that it's not amazing, I just don't like it), and something to melt the high executioner / sepulchre / watch captain. Whatever way you choose to fill those niches, do it.

Double blunder? by Simple-Slammer in backgammon

[–]seintris_ 1 point2 points  (0 children)

A common indicator to make an anchor in the early stages of the game arises when your opponent either splits his back checkers, as in your example, or when he has made an anchor of his own. The value of your own anchor rises in value when your opponent's checkers are in these positions because (when he has an anchor) he can mount attacks without fearing total retaliation and blunt your priming / blitzing threat, leaving a mutual holding game your best chance to win or (when he is split) he can make a play for a racing lead or a high anchor, the value of which has been discussed.

Double blunder? by Simple-Slammer in backgammon

[–]seintris_ 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Not only are you a) making an inferior anchor and priming yourself, you are also b) leaving a blot for your opponent to shoot at when he has you outboarded 2 to 1. The 23 anchor is usually a "any port in a storm" anchor. You're not happy to make it most of the time. You have a chance to upgrade to a perfectly workable anchor at a time when your opponent's priming threat is beginning, mostly neutralizing his attempt. 22 pt is clear.
